It would appear that the same is true for the players themselves, at least when it comes to former Ottawa Senators defenseman Marc Methot. Methot caught wind of some disappointed fans of the Ottawa Senators discussing a rather infamous goal from Toronto Maple Leafs star forward Auston Matthews, one in which Matthews embarrasses a number of players playing for the Senators at the time.

Methot is of course on the wrong side of that particular highlight but when it comes to taking blame for the unfortunate situation, from the perspective of the Senators at least, Methot is simply having none of it. When one disappointed Sens fan argued that "every sens player was soft as baby shit here" Methot fired back by not only defending himself, but also by throwing a pair of former teammates under the bus.

"I legitimately do not think I could have played this better," wrote Methot. "I blame my partner followed by Craig Anderson for playing behind the goal line."

That "partner" is of course none other than San Jose Sharks star defenseman Erik Karlsson, a player many believe will win the Norris Trophy for this season, and he does get his pocket picked by Matthews on the play. Methot is of course just having some fun at the expense of his former teammates and it's fantastic.
